Output 258c0692538271957299b8e92de5473c626e473a044a18feacf6c7a3c92a625d:13

value
43446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ca360ca874e22dbdcc7d5ac4d6b35debe70d032 OP_EQUAL
address
38gEzqBj7QqCXhqbqe4yPA3KmoF1miK2vX
transaction
258c0692538271957299b8e92de5473c626e473a044a18feacf6c7a3c92a625d
spent
true